Apostol came to the United States in the early 1900's. He was second husband to Maria Trainoff, father to James Trainoff and step-father to Robert Boris Boskoff and Virginia (Veselina) Boskoff. He was a farmer and even after retirement was known to go help pick the fields, which we believe is why he was in Blythe when he passed away. I heard many stories over the years about how he made his own wine in a basement he dug himself in Eastern Los Angeles and how the Greek and Yugoslav neighbors would always come for a visit and a celebration when Apostol was fermenting his wine and brandies. My mother also said how he was a wonderful gardener and how she enjoyed being in the yard with him as a young girl. I never met him but I think we would have had a wonderful relationship. He and Maria obtained a marriage license in 1925 but did not have a certificate until 1953. We're not sure why and there's no one to confirm though I believe they may have believed they were married with just the license.
